Output 31ae26fdabbdd2c7dfdd861aa03c8b03479f62a0bd6624e4f6f80fad7cd5c304:0

value
17478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b31039ca811ec498b32fdd6543c2f49a70764e64 OP_EQUALVERIFY OP_CHECKSIG
address
1HKoPitg16LERy2H3eRGxYxitFUEEzCkBA
transaction
31ae26fdabbdd2c7dfdd861aa03c8b03479f62a0bd6624e4f6f80fad7cd5c304
confirmations
45352
spent
false